Aalto-Korkeakoulusäätiö sr, a prominent mobile network operating in Finland (Europe) under Mobile Country Code (MCC) 244 and Mobile Network Code (MNC) 56, plays a specific role within the Finnish telecommunications landscape. Its inclusion in the national infrastructure contributes to research, education and academic purposes. The network exists alongside major players like Elisa, DNA and Telia, yet its functionalities are usually dedicated to specific institutional purposes.
